What is Comfortcore?

Comfortcore is a style of home design that combines comfort and practicality. It focuses on creating a cozy, inviting atmosphere in your home that also looks great. To achieve this look, designers use natural materials like wood, stone, and plants as well as comfortable furniture, soft colors, and inviting textures. Comfortcore also utilizes elements of minimalism, so that the space isn’t too cluttered or overwhelming.
